GRE:针对大规模图处理的一种新型算法框架
在大数据时代,图的分析和挖掘是一类非常重要的应用.其中,一大类的图算法可以用遍历模式来实现.本文通过对图遍历算法的基本计算特征进行分析,给出了一个新的实现图遍历算法的框架—GRE.GRE采用扩展的广度优先搜索(GBFS)作为编程模型,同时底层提供统一的Runtime环境.用户只需要要对GBFS的基本操作原语进行实例化,就可以实现具体的算法.本文同时给出了三个典型的图遍历算法,即BFS,SSSP和PageRank的GRE实现.
图遍历算法 大规模图处理 编程模型 并行算法
YAN Jie 闫洁 TAN Guang-Ming 谭光明 SUN Ning-Hui 孙凝晖
Institute of Computing Technology,Chinese Academy of Sciences,Beijing 100190,China;State Key Laborat 中国科学院计算技术研究所,北京 100190;计算机体系结构国家重点实验室,中国科学院计算技术研究所,北京 100190;中科院大学,北京 100190 Institute of Computing Technology,Chinese Academy of Sciences,Beijing 100190,China;State Key Laborat 中国科学院计算技术研究所,北京 100190;计算机体系结构国家重点实验室,中国科学院计算技术研究所,北京 100190 Institute of Computing Technology,Chinese Academy of Sciences,Beijing 100190,China 中国科学院计算技术研究所,北京 100190
国内会议
张家界
中文
1-8
2012-10-29(万方平台首次上网日期,不代表论文的发表时间)